Senate Democrats signal they're prepared to block GOP police reform bill on WednesdayDemocratic senators on Monday gave their strongest indications yet they may block the GOP's police reform bill from coming to the floor, a risky move that could prevent any overhaul measure from being enacted this year over their party's concerns that the GOP bill is far too weak.
Sen. Mazie Hirono, a Hawaii Democrat, said Scott’s bill"doesn’t do what we should be doing which is doing honest police reform."
